        According to the reports I've seen, it wasn't 'technically' speeding - it was actually speeding - that is, its speed was greater than the applicable speed limit. Many people take the view that the posted speed limit is advisory, and being a few miles per hour (or kilometres per hour) over the limit is O.K., so long as you don't exceed some imaginary leeway. Such leeway is assumed by drivers in the UK as 10% + 2 mph*, so 35 in a 30 zone is OK, but legally, anything over the posted number is breaking the law, even if it is difficult to prove (radar sensor accuracy and stability since the last calibration is arguable in court).
        I think it is reasonable to require an autonomous vehicle to observe the limits - if you can only measure velocity to a certain accuracy, make sure your error margins don't exceed the posted speed. Car speedometers already do this: they deliberately read over the actual speed, as manufacturers are held to high standards on this point - speedometers are allowed to show higher than the actual speed, but not lower.

        Doing 38 in a 35 zone doesn't seem like much, but it adds 17.9% to the kinetic energy of the vehicle, and reduces the reaction time by 7.9% - that's enough to turn an accident that 'merely' injures a pedestrian (or just misses them) into a fatal accident. Someone else on this discussion has posted the pedestrian fatality rates by speed of collision at 20/30/40 mph. It's one reason (of several) why 20mph limits in residential areas is becoming more popular.

        *Some semi-official bodies have publicised this as a recommendation, basically saying that most (not all) police forces in the UK tend to apply that rule, but will apply the limits exactly if it is deemed justified i.e. you have been driving like a pillock and/or had an accident.

            That's just it though. Speedometers read a touch low. So if you are intentionally keeping your speed at 60km/h as shown by the speedo, and then climb to 62km/h by accident you are still ok. The manufacturers deliberately calibrate the speedos to overestimate your speed.

            The standard in the UK for examples is that a speedo must *never* show less than the actual speed, and must never show more than 110% of actual speed + 6.25mph. So at 100mph, its legal for your speedo to show anything from 100mph to 116.25mph. And from my (limited) experience most will probably show around 105-110. So if you are driving, and intentionally keeping it at 100mph as read by the speedo, you are *really* going mid-90s, and if you drift up to 102 now and again that's fine.

            Plus most speed traps themselves give a small bit of grace; to account for their own potential for error, except they are calibrated 'the other way'. So your speedo is always overestimating your speed (to ensure it never reads lower than you really are going), and police radar is underestimating it to ensure they never give you a ticket when you are within the limit, and the upshot is that if your speedo says 2km/h over the limit, you should have nothing to worry about.           That's unrealistic given the way gasoline automobiles work. It doesn't take much external force to alter the car's velocity a small amount. The nature of the drive train means over & under corrections are inevitable. A slight rise or dip in the terrain or a gust of wind would be plenty to change the car's velocity by a few MPH. The physical system that the computer is controlling (engine & brakes) isn't accurate enough to avoid inevitable overshoot when the computer applies control. You can see that at work with a simple cruise control on human-driven cars.

          The only way you'd get a control system to keep the car exactly at a given speed would be to have it constantly alternate gas & brake to speed up and slow down. That's ruinously bad for mileage and the mechanical lifespan of the car, and would make for a really bumpy ride, but that's the least of the problems. A car constantly braking & accelerating would appear erratic to other drivers, probably resulting in them speeding around it to "get away from" the erratic driver.

          Until/unless 100% of cars become fully autonomous, self-driving cars need to behave in a fashion that's similar to what human drivers expect of other human drivers. Drifting a few MPH over or under the posted limit is normal, and thus it's actually the safest way for an autonomous car to behave. The reactions of human drivers around it are the most likely source of accidents.

            While I don't do it very often, I can keep within 1 mph of any speed limit on a reasonably flat straight road. Oftentimes even on curves and differing grades if I have the patience and attention. A robot has none of these limitations and having worked on cars from the 90s through late 2000s, I can tell you almost all of them have both the sensors and the ECU/ABS speedometer accuracy to hold speed at tenths of a mph within the vehicles operating range, and that is on MANUAL cars. Automatic cars with ABS, TCS, throttle and steering by wire should have no problems under conditions outside of 5mph or 5 percent grade in holding their speed steady at or below the posted speed limit. Furthermore having had a discussion about this just the other day: Most of the modern net-enabled GPS navigation systems have sign-accurate speed limit markers including with their navigation service, to notify you to slow down/speed up on a stretch of road. Given that, there really is no excuse for an autonomous car to not be driving almost exactly the speed limit. The entire point of autonomous vehicles is to provide better safety, reliability, and reproducability than human drivers can. If they aren't doing that then they fail at autonomous cars.
